Added features include the practice squad, full-player editing, and the in-game ticker that keeps you updated with scores from around the league. Know your opponents’ tendencies every week, then pick the right drills to attack and counter those tendencies in game. This new level of strategy promises to deliver more variety and more fun when preparing for your next opponent, whether it’s a user or a computer simulated player. [Electronic Arts] Expand

They didn’t change everything though and kept their classic gameplay modes like Franchise.
    This year madden featured Franchise mode in their game and it played off. Their motto is “Take your team all the way and put yourself in the middle of your team's franchise mode. The game mode has 3 basic options in the beginning. You get to chose between being a player, coach, or owner. As a player you can either create one or play as a real player in the league. As a player, You can choose between 4 different positions. (Quarterback, Running Back, Wide Receiver, and Tight End) You earn points from playing games and practice. You use those points to Upgrade your player and make him better. If you choose to become a coach this is like the regular season mode. You set season goals and if you reach them you can upgrade your coach to help be more persuasive in free agency. In this mode you get to play as any of the 32 teams in the NFL. Your goal in this mode is to win the superbowl. You can play with up to 32 different people and each person has there own team. In the owner mode you can to call all the shots, you can move your team to a different city, sign free agents, and control your coaching staff.
    Madden this year created a brand new ball carrier moves. This makes it easier to stiff arm, hurdle, dive, or spin move a defender. With all the detail going into one moment of the game, I’m really surprised it runs that fluidly. EA sports also, improved it graphics and online gameplay. Beside some glitches and lags, the online gameplay has improved extremely from madden 16. Some of the things it has improved from madden 16, is the brand new kicking meter which makes it possible to miss and extra point or field goal. Another major change is that player ratings matter when performing ball carrier moves, the ratings might determine if you perform the move or not, before it was just user timing. Online game modes include Draft Champions (draft player and compete against other online gamers with your team) and online franchise. (play a season against other online gamers)

Disclaimer: I'm not that interested in draft/franchise mode or whatever it's called. I want to play football, not manage a football team. From a gameplay standpoint, the changes to the mechanics in running actual plays are disastrous. The additional run controls are so subtle and have to be so exactly executed as to make them worthless. Worse, if you miss and hit the wrong run influence or your control combination is delayed, you will likely do something much worse, like make the runner stop. The non-speed version of the controls (without trigger held) are almost sure play-killers because they momentarily stop the runner in his tracks. As further proof of this problem, we've gone from having way to many kickoff returns in Madden15 to making it virtually impossible to get a long kickoff return in Madden17. It's simply impossible to get a good enough juke that you can get past more than one player. I've played literally hundreds of games of 17 and haven't seen a single long kickoff return (by myself or my opponents). And what's with the horrible lag on making a QB roll out of the pocket and run? There are times I've held the control down only to watch the QB stubbornly sit in the pocket, or worse, stutter back and forth from starting to run to trying to pass. I saw one post suggesting a trick in which you double tap on the control, holding it down the second time. I have managed to get that to work occasionally to force the QB out of the pocket. Even then, sometimes he will still stop mid-run and cock his arm back to pass. For all practical purposes this ability to QB run just no longer works. It has taken some categories of plays, like many Play Action, out of the playbook entirely. Worse, if you want to play a team like the Panthers or Seahawks where a full out QB run is an option, it's impossible. It has crippled those teams' play. The pass-catching influencing controls were a great idea, but don't seem to work at all. Possession catch seems to be the only one that actually does anything (I've never seen Aggressive Catch work, even with very sure-handed receivers). Similarly, interception defense almost always results in allowing the catch, even with a top-tier cornerback doing it. So disappointing to see such a digression for this franchise. It's all slick glitter and polish and just horribly frustrating gameplay mechanics. Expand
